  1. Kenneth Harper (1913–1998) was an English film producer. He produced 13 films between 1954 and 1973. He was a member of the jury at the 21st Berlin International Film Festival. He produced the first films of Peter Yates and Ken Russell and four films starring Cliff Richard.

  7. Mar 28, 2022 · RALEIGH, NC – High Point native and entrepreneur Kenneth J. Harper has announced his candidacy for the U.S. Senate seat that will be made vacant by the retirement of the U.S. Sen. Richard Burr. Harper officially filed with the North Carolina State Board of Elections March 1, 2022.
